Hello, Here is a situation which I faced, that can be reproduced.
I did "heat resource-signal" multiple times simultaneously to scale instance. As a result 3 resources were made in the scaling group having max_size=2. "stack-list -n" showed me 3 stacks in one parent. Heat itself seems not to actually check resource data in the database. Is there any lock/unlock mechanism like mutex in heat implementation like locking database when auto-scaling feature is triggered. Or is there plan to deploy such a mutex mechanism. What I'm concerning about more is that cielometer also has some feature to triggering auto-scaling. So I would like to make sure that there is a mechanism to keep data consistency on each component.
